Mail trick under Tiger

mailI wasn’t aware of this until I read about it over at Wishingline. If you do a "get info" (Command-i) on any mailbox in Tiger's version of Mail, an Account Info window appears. From there you can do all sorts of useful things, including check on your current quota limits, adjust the behavior of the drafts, sent items and junk mail folders of that particular mailbox and edit the contents of any of that mailboxes' subfolders. Pretty handy. I tried to do the same under Panther and it did not work.
